Sec. 4. Updating 90/10 disclosure and data reporting requirements

Section 487(d) of the Higher Education Act of 1965 ( 20 U.S.C. 1094(d) ) is amended by striking paragraphs
(3)and
(4)and inserting the following: The Secretary shall publicly disclose on the College Navigator, or its successor, website— the name of any proprietary institution of higher education that fails to meet the requirement of subsection (a)(24); and the applicable sanction on such institution that failed to meet such requirement. The Secretary of Veterans Affairs shall— publicly disclose on the GI Bill Comparison Tool website, or its successor, the name of any proprietary institution of higher education that fails to meet the requirement of subsection (a)(24); publicly disclose the applicable sanction on such institution that failed to meet such requirement, and include a caution flag with such disclosure; and remove a caution flag included under clause
(ii)after the Secretary of Education certifies that such institution has demonstrated compliance with the eligibility requirements of subsection (a)(24). Not later than July 1, 2020, and July 1 of each succeeding year, the Secretary shall submit to the authorizing committees a report that contains, for each proprietary institution of higher education that receives Federal educational assistance (as defined in subsection (a)(24)(B)), as provided in the audited financial statements submitted to the Secretary by each institution pursuant to the requirements of subsection (a)(24)— the amount and percentage of such institution's revenues received from Federal educational assistance (as defined in subsection (a)(24)(B)), disaggregated by the source of the assistance; and the amount and percentage of such institution's revenues received from other sources. .
